When you tried to render the Timeline containing the 1080p60, was there an orange line, green line, or no colored line over its content on the Timeline? If you have no colored line or a green line, there is no rendering when you press the Render Button or press Enter or go Timeline/Render Work Area, just playback of your Timeline. The colored line indicator system is the program telling you whether or not it feels that you are getting the best possible preview for what you are seeing in the Edit Mode monitor at playback. With no colored line or green indicator, no rendering since the program feels that you are getting the best possible preview. You realize that once you edit that "rendered" clip it will require rendering to get the best possible preview of what you then have. If orange line over time and you render, you know the rendering process is complete when the orange line is completely replaced by a green one.

    Here are a few ideas off the top of my head:
    Try playing the file using a different xtra, sometimes different ones will work better.  If you have Director 11.5, there is a native flv playback xtra.
    You can build a player easily in Flash using the flvPlayback component, then bring that into Director as a swf.
    Once you have the video in Director, try making the member Direct To Stage (DTS).  If it is already DTS, try making it not DTS.
    Make sure the video is not transparent, and nothing in Director overlaps the video... in fact, when the video is playing, nothing should be moving at all, and try to keep the amount of code that is running to a minimum.
    Try lowering your video's data rate further or try using a different codec.
    Using VBR (Variable Bit Rate) compression often makes the video appear to play smoother.
    Try compressing the flv with different software.  FFMpeg, for example, is free and does a very good job, often better than the Flash Video Encoder that comes with Flash/Creative Suite.

    Yup...that's a problem. FCP and H.264 don't mix.  Sync issues, export issues...don't edit H.264 native in FCP, period.  If you use FCP 7 or earlier, you MUST convert your footage to an editing codec, like ProRes.  And use ProRes sequence settings. 
    A quick fix you can try is to go into the sequence settings, change the COMPRESSOR to ProRes 422...and render the sequence, then export.
